Here's a quick summary...
Research generally suggests longer posts do better on search. Between 1,000 and 2,500 words is seen as ideal!
Longer posts work because they simply contain more content to rank on.
Plus, they give more value, helping to further increase rankings!
But, sometimes short posts do better!
Sound confusing?
Yeah!...
In truth, it really just depends on the keyword. Some need shorter, more snappy answers, so just focus on maximizing value for the visitor!
But remember, longer posts are generally preferable as they provide more repurposing opportunities.
